Wendy and Morgan were married this past Sunday, Canada Day! What a fun day to be married. The morning started at Wendy’s family’s apartment, getting ready with her parents, her brother and her bridesmaids. Excitement was in the air as the bridesmaids prepared 4 different challenges for the groomsmen, aka, “Door Games!” (Always a blast to photograph.)
When Wendy was in her beautiful gown, we went down to meet Morgan on another floor in the apartment. When they arrived, Morgan and the boys had to complete these four different challenges (with Wendy hidden away!) — until Morgan was allowed to have his First Look with his bride. The men aced the challenges, and had great attitudes, winning Morgan his bride!
Two tea ceremonies were held in the morning, for both sides of the family, before we drove to Deer Lake Park for wedding party portraits. I love what we captured. Wendy and Morgan’s look: formal suit and black bow tie, off-the-shoulder gown with a loose, ethereal bouquet… I was obsessed!
Wendy & Morgan’s ceremony and reception was held at Riverway Clubhouse in Burnaby, and it was my first time photographing at Riverway’s renovated ceremony site! It’s so bright and lovely and green; the perfect place for a summer wedding. Enjoy!
